Address

D6csTUWa6qyxpwdE2P2nKxPqm3RgezLJhwCopy

Total Received

4183.542734 XVG

Total Sent

4183.542734 XVG

№ Transactions

7686

Final Balance

0 XVG

Transactions
Filter